The solar plexus chakra, also known as the Manipura chakra, is the third chakra in the body’s energy system. Located in the upper abdomen, this chakra is associated with personal power, confidence, and self-esteem. When the solar plexus chakra is balanced, we feel a strong sense of self-worth and are able to assert ourselves with ease.

Restorative yoga is a gentle and calming practice that focuses on deep relaxation and stress relief. It involves holding poses for longer periods of time, allowing the body and mind to fully relax and unwind. One particular aspect of restorative yoga is heart opening poses, which aim to release tension in the chest and shoulders, and promote a sense of openness and compassion.
